Large Goods Vehicle (LGV) or Heavy Goods Vehicle (HGV) training is the training being provided for the goods carrying vehicles that are being used for various purposes. These vehicles do not carry passengers. These include Lorries, Trucks, etc.

Passenger Carrying Vehicle (PCV) Training is the training for driving the vehicles carrying passengers from place to place. These vehicles include buses, vans, etc.

Certificate of Professional Competence (CPC) is the certificate given to the driver making him eligible for driving the vehicles.Category1 (C1) License Training is the training provided to the learners for driving medium sized vehicles weighing between 3500 and 7500 kg. C1 + E License Training are the training which permits the driver to drive the vehicle of the load varying from 3500 to 7500 kg along with an extra load of 750 kg. C1-E 7.5Training is the training that tells to driver how to drive the trailers of the weight 750 kg but should not exceed the weight of the vehicle. C up to 32 tons Training is the training being provided to the driver that gives him the guidance to drive any rigid lorry weighing up to 32tonnes. C+E Truck and trailer Training is the training that teaches the learner to drive trailers including Articulated Vehicles with the combination of Drawbar weighing up to 44 tonnes. D1 Minibus Training teaches the learner to drive the mini bus having the capacity of 16 passengers. D 1 + E Training are the training being given to make the learners understand how to drive the vehicles with 18 passengers carrying the weight of the trailer of not more than 750 kg. D Automatic Bus Training is the training that teaches the driver to drive a newly featured bus with the facilities of wheel chair for differently abled passengers. D + E Coach and Trailer Training guide the driver to drive the vehicle with the accommodation of more than 8 passengers
